Prime Minister Omar Razzaz visited on Sunday, April 28, 2019, the Integrity and Anti-Corruption Commission, where he stressed the joint work of the Jordanian government and the Integrity and Anti-Corruption Commission in enforcing the royal directive, which indicates that there is no immunity for any corrupt.

During his visit, Razzaz vowed, "there is no impunity for a corrupt person in the Kingdom.”

Razzaz also stressed the importance of the support and full independence of the Commission’s work to enable it to play its important and pivotal role within the anti-corruption system and the protection of public money.
